Oklahoma Wesleyan University (OKWU) is a private, Christian liberal arts institution located in Bartlesville, Oklahoma. Established in 1909, OKWU offers undergraduate and graduate programs in various fields of study. With a strong commitment to the integration of faith, learning, and living, OKWU provides a Christ-centered education that prepares students for leadership roles in their chosen careers and communities.

At Oklahoma Wesleyan University, students can choose from a wide range of academic programs. Undergraduate majors include fields like Business Administration, Education, Ministry and Bible, Nursing, Psychology, and many more. The university also offers adult and graduate programs in subjects such as Business Administration, Healthcare Administration, and Organizational Leadership. With small class sizes, students receive individualized attention and have opportunities for meaningful interactions with their professors.

OKWU emphasizes the integration of faith and education, encouraging students to develop a biblical worldview and a strong Christian character. The university believes that education goes beyond the classroom, and students are encouraged to engage in service-learning, internships, and spiritual development activities. Oklahoma Wesleyan University is affiliated with the Wesleyan Church and provides a vibrant campus environment with various student organizations, athletics, and chapel services, fostering a sense of community and spiritual growth among the student body.

Oklahoma Wesleyan University is a private university located in Bartlesville, OK. This academic institution uses a semester-based calendar. It has an acceptance rate of 66%. The freshman retention rate at Oklahoma Wesleyan University is 50% and the six-year graduation rate is 26%.

Retention Rate

The student retention rate is the percentage of students who re-enroll from one year to the next. When creating your list of possible schools to attend, make sure to consider the freshmen retention rate.

The freshman retention rate for Oklahoma Wesleyan University was 50% in 2022.

The graduation rate is another indicator to take into account. This metric measures how efficiently students complete their degrees within a specific time period. This academic institution has the six-year graduation rate of 26%.

Main Student Body

The overall number of students enrolled at Oklahoma Wesleyan University in 2022 was 880.

The school reported an out-of-state student body portion of 44% for that year. The total number of undergraduate students enrolled at the school was 765, 46 of which were international students. The school reported to have a total of 125 transfer students.

Student Population Gender Ratio

The student body is coeducational, with 349 male and 292 female full-time students in 2022.

This school had 10 Asian students and 51 Afro-American students in 2022. 71 undergraduates at this school identified as Hispanic/Latino and 58 as multirace. The school also had 2 students who declared as Native Hawaiian or other Pacific Islander, and 35 American Indian or Alaska Native students. There were also 25 students whose ethnicity is unknown.

Tuition and Fees

If you were wondering how much the tuition cost for Oklahoma Wesleyan University is, here are some recent data that will come in handy.

Tuition fees per academic year for full-time domestic students were $31,550 in 2022. As this is a private institution, tuition is the same for all the accepted students. Fees per academic year required of full-time students reached $2,662 in 2022.

Books and Supplies

Another important expense to take into consideration is the approximate cost of books and supplies for a college or university. Most students have to allocate about $1,348 for books and supplies during their time at Oklahoma Wesleyan University.

Boarding

Besides tuition, another cost to consider is the price of housing in the dorms and eating at the school cafeteria. How much do room and board fees average around at colleges and universities?

At Oklahoma Wesleyan University, the 2022 annual cost of room and board (on campus) was $9,800. The cost of a dorm room only at this school in 2022 amounted to $5,100 for one academic year.

Financial Aid

There are different types of financial aid: grants, loans, scholarships, and work-study programs. If you are interested in finding out more about need-based and non-need-based aid at Oklahoma Wesleyan University, here are some recent data you should consider.

The most recent records show that 188 freshmen received some sort of financial help. The average amount of financial aid given to students was $17,022.

Need-based

Financial aid that a student can receive if they are determined to have financial need and meet other eligibility requirements is known as need-based aid.

There were 486 students who received need-based financial aid of any kind. Need-based college-administered scholarship and grant aid at Oklahoma Wesleyan University is available to international students. The overall number of students (including freshmen) who were determined to have financial need came to be 491. The amount of federal need-based scholarships/grants awarded to the students at this institution totaled $2,093,933, and state $445,097. The students of Oklahoma Wesleyan University received the -institutional need-based aid in the amount of $2,540,669, and external in the amount of $488,645.

Non-Need Based

Non-need-based aid is any type of financial aid given to a student who does not meet the requirements for need-based aid. Non-need-based student aid typicaly comes in a form of Direct Unsubsidized Stafford Loans, Graduate PLUS Loans, Parent PLUS Loans, and the Teacher Education Access for College and Higher Education (TEACH) Grant.

43 students, including freshmen, received institutional non-need-based financial aid at this institution in 2022. Institutional help in the form of non-need-based scholarships or grants was given to 22 full-time freshmen. The total amount of institutional scholarships and awards that were not based on financial need was $882,330. This includes endowment, alumni, other institutional awards, and also external funds awarded by the institution, but doesn't include athletic aid and tuition waivers. The amount the students of this school received from external sources (e.g. Kiwanis, National Merit) was $235,463 USD.

Campus Life

Knowing what to expect out of campus life at a college or university can set you up for success. Check out some details about campus life at Oklahoma Wesleyan University.

It has a campus size of 27 acres.

Student Organizations

Involvement in student organizations can make your educational experience more dynamic and gratifying.

There are 10 student organizations and groups with open membership at this school. The student organization that gathers the largest number of students is Student Government Groups, followed by intramurals and Missions Support Groups. Other popular organizations among the students at Oklahoma Wesleyan University are Fellowship of Christian Athletes and Operation Saturation (Community Service Opportunities).

There is a drama club you can join if acting is something that interests you. For students looking to explore media and communication, Oklahoma Wesleyan University publishes its own newspaper.
